Pulse oximeter is a tool to calculate the volume of oxygen present in your blood. Most recent models of these devices like the CMS pulse oximeters has an alarm that triggers when the oxygen level of the user is dropping into a none safe level. The good thing about this device is that, it does not necessarily need to introduce the instrument into your body to start taking tests.

The device works in a simple way. There are two lights that are equipped to it, an infrared and a red light, which is produced by the light emitter. Two different lights well try to pass into the hemoglobin of the users blood. If a certain hemoglobin is oxygenated, it consumes more infrared and let the red light go through while the deoxygenated hemoglobin works in a complete opposite way. For the tool to compute the oxygenation level, a photoreceptor catches the emitted light and count the oxygenation that is present.

Most people attached this in a body part where there is a good blood flow. For babies, across its foot is a good part to secure it in, this ensures an accurate result. You can also put this in your earlobe or your fingertips where a perfect bloodstream is present.

Oximeter comes from the phrase oxygen meter, which basically what the gadget do. The person who coined the name is a British researcher way back 1940s. The system went through a lot of modifications to ensure it provides an almost perfect result.

The good thing about the device is that, it is portable. Before, the device is huge that it seems to be not that useful as if it is today. The rapid improvement of technology was able to decrease the size of the tool by integrating nanotechnology into it.
